Musicians can be dime-a-dozen, but there is only one man known as tha K-MAN. The Biloxi, Mississippi native was always into music, the arts, and more, but it wouldn’t be till 2012 that tha K-MAN began hitting the ground running in the music realm. And since that time... has manifested into a versatile and multifaceted wordsmith with an insatiable drive and determination to make it to the top. His music ranges from Hip-Hop to Rock.

Known for a very dynamic and innovative rhyming technique, tha K-MAN has built on a craft that gives him his own signature sound and stylization that stems from life experiences, and also a vast array of eclectic artist influences over the years. Some of his cornerstone musical inspirations range from industry heavyweights including J. Cole, Nas, Eminem, Johnny Cash, George Strait, Frank Sinatra, and a multitude of different artists from many genres.

A majority of his music springs from personal experiences within his life, and those he calls "true family". None as personal as his 2016 "Final Good-bye", which focused on three very "close to the heart" situations. His loss of his father to a drug overdose (not knowing if it was accidental or not), a death of a close friend, and a love that was in a right place, but wrong time were the driving force behind it all.

But it was his hip-hop single from 2012, “Calm Before the Storm”, that would spark the lightening in his heart and thunder in his soul for actually putting his music out there for the world and more to hear. The very next year, tha K-MAN would go on to release his first EP, “Story of a Lifetime”, including five other songs, along with his debut single.

In December 2017, tha K-MAN released his acclaimed single “My Wolves”, which amassed a prominent street buzz and garnered the artist many new listeners. With a more darker tone in the song, it has been his most menacing song to date. It wasn’t all gloom for tha K-MAN, however. In that same year, with his love of the Spanish culture, he released “Spanish Butterfly”. A song he is quoted as saying was inspired by musician/actress, Selena Gomez.

2018 saw the release his first ever instrumental album, "Wild Run" - Inspired by his novel of the same name (released in 2009). From there on, 2018 was found to be a very busy year for tha K-MAN with the release of a new “Rockin’” sound from the artist. “Decision Time”, which was also an instrumental, would have tha K-MAN cross the music streams and have him producing a rock rhythm. He would top off the year with the holiday season of 2018 by creating magic with his instrumental, “Timeless Memory”— A Christmas melody, set to remind everyone of the joyful Christmases of the past.

2019 would bring more from the never-ending creative mind of tha K-MAN as he would release two new songs, including one that would be connected with raising money for St. Jude’s Children’s Hospital. For the first three months of it’s release, tha K-MAN donated 100% profits from his single release, “1 Life, 1 Choice, 1 Sacrifice”, to the charity. As fashioning as the year prior, tha K-MAN would end his music year as he walked through the shadows of the night with his All-Hallows-Eve inspired instrumental, “Creatures of Darkness”.

2020 would finally bring forth two projects from tha K-MAN. First being an instrumental piece that consisted of Rock with a little bit of Soul in it, in the release of “Back to the Roots”. K-MAN said it was his way of going back to the music he grew up listening to in that of Country, Rock ‘n Roll, and Soul. To round out the year, he would release a “Best of tha K-MAN” album—the first full album since his “Story of a Lifetime” EP. Tracks on the album included a mini interview from the mastermind, and how he created each of his creations. Along with fan favorites from tha K-MAN, he included a new song, “What Are We Standing For?”-- A rewritten country (now Hip-Hop) song he wrote in 2010, and the inspiration behind his 2013 documentary, “Veterans UnAffairs: the Frank Gann Story”. The Album also included two pop bonus instrumental tracks-- Both produced by tha K-MAN. It had been rumored, at that time, that this would be his last album, but like with all things in life, nothing is guaranteed. As dually noted with the release of a new holiday-ish winter instrumental in 2022 titled “Winter Battle” and then his 2023 Electronic/Pop instrumental “Unbreakable”. As tha K-MAN is quoted as saying, after the release of “X the Boundaries (Best Of...)”, “It will be up to the fans on that one.” Regardless, tha K-MAN is said to be working on a Country single that he wishes to release in the near future, and is now host of a Podcast properly named, “Thoughts of a Krazy MAN”.
